Siemens Automation and Drives (A&D) will present new integrated safety functions for the Sinumerik 840D solution line control system at this year's EMO trade show. They meet all the requirements to SIL2 (Safety Integrity Level / IEC 61508) as well as PL d (Performance Level/EN ISO 13849-1), and they have the relevant certification.

There are now sufficient safe cams available for detecting up to 30 traversing ranges. Safe communication via standard Profibus between several Sinumerik 840D sl systems significantly simplifies plant installation. The new DP/AS-I F-Link implements a safe transition from ASIsafe to Profisafe for the first time. The compact network transition (F-Link) collects safety-related signals via the AS-i bus and transfers them via Profibus to the higher-level F controller. This enables simple and low-cost connection between the two bus systems.

With the safe digital electronics module 4F-DI/3F-DO for Profisafe, the ET 200S I/O system now has a module available that is specially tailored to the requirements of machine tools. The electronics module offers four safe inputs and three safe outputs and fulfills the requirements both of SIL2 (IEC 61508) and PL d (EN ISO 13849). It can be used in the Sinumerik 840 D sl as well as in the Sinumerik 840D powerline.
